Couple who died in car fire didn’t attempt to exit

MCFARLAND, Wis. — McFarland’s police chief says the couple found dead in a burned out car early New Year’s Day never attempted to get out of the vehicle.

Chief Craig Sherven says that indicates the couple may have been asleep or unconscious as fire burned the car. The deaths of 24-year-old Brandon Slattery and 21-year-old Amy Damon, both of Edgerton, have been ruled accidental.

Sherven says there’s no indication of foul play. The chief tells the State Journal both Slattery and Damon appeared to have been sitting in the front seats.

Funeral services for the two were held Monday.
